The postcode BN18 0EP is located in Arun, in the county of West Sussex.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. BN18 0EP is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

BN18 0EP is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.9 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of BN18 0EP as Rural residents > Rural tenants > Rural life.

The closest road name to BN18 0EP is The Poplars which is centered 204 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Village Hall and is 373 m away. The closest railway station is Ford Rail Station, 2.18 km away.

The closest primary school to BN18 0EP (for ages 11 and under) is Yapton CE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on December 2, 2016.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is St Philip Howard Catholic School. The last OFSTED inspection on October 6, 2021 rated this school as Outstanding

The local pub for residents of BN18 0EP is Maypole Inn and is 845 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on December 15, 2021. The nearest takeaway food is available from Yapton Chippy and is 395 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on February 17, 2022.

Residents reported an average download speed of 27.2 Mbps and an average upload speed of 4.6 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 4.1 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for BN18 0EP is covered by the Sussex police force association and West Sussex is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
